Le impostazioni predefinite per la selezione del menu di timeout di GRUB2 durante l'avvio del sistema sono 5 secondi. Per modificare questo valore, apri /etc/default/grub
file di configurazione predefinito di grub. Il contenuto del file è simile a quello mostrato di seguito:
GRUB_TIMEOUT=5GRUB_DISTRIBUTOR="$(sed 's, release .*$,,g' /etc/system-release)"GRUB_DEFAULT=savedGRUB_DISABLE_SUBMENU=trueGRUB_TERMINAL_OUTPUT="console"GRUB_CMDLINE_LINUX="rd.lvm.lv=rhel/ root crashkernel=auto \ rd.lvm.lv=rhel/swap vconsole.font=latarcyrheb-sun16 vconsole.keymap=us rhgb quiet"GRUB_DISABLE_RECOVERY="true"
Per modificare le impostazioni di timeout è sufficiente aggiornare il GRUB_TIMEOUT
GRUB2 direttiva il numero desiderato di secondi che desideri che GRUB2 attenda fino a quando non effettui la selezione del menu di avvio. Ad esempio, per fare in modo che GRUB 2 attenda 20 secondi, cambia questo valore in:
GRUB_TIMEOUT=20
Nel caso in cui non desideri che il menu di GRUB 2 appaia/disabilita, cambia il valore in 0 secondi:
GRUB_TIMEOUT=0
Dopo aver aggiornato le impostazioni, aggiorna le impostazioni di GRUB2 usando grub2-mkconfig
comando per creare un nuovo file di configurazione GRUB2 aggiornato:
[root@rhel7 ~]# grub2-mkconfig -o /boot/grub2/grub.cfg Generazione del file di configurazione di grub ...Trovato un'immagine Linux:/boot/vmlinuz-3.10.0-123.el7.x86_64Trovato un'immagine initrd :/boot/initramfs-3.10.0-123.el7.x86_64.img Immagine linux trovata:/boot/vmlinuz-0-rescue-75387b56d72b48b380810499805ec28a Immagine initrd trovata:/boot/initramfs-0-rescue-75387b56d708a.80mg5bdone8